Nampula — In Mozambique, the resumption of school activities in the country has been postponed until 27 February 2026. The decision was taken by the country’s Council of Ministers following the severe repercussions caused by the floods (see Fides, 21/1/2026).
Since the start of the rainy season, which runs from October to April, including the last two weeks of flooding, 125 people have died in Mozambique and 774,828 have been severely affected. Hundreds of families remain surrounded by water,…
